Last Updated at 11 October 2024MPPS NANDIGANIPALLI: A Rural Primary School in Andhra Pradesh
MPPS NANDIGANIPALLI is a government-run primary school located in the rural heart of Andhra Pradesh. Established in 1985, this co-educational institution caters to students from Class 1 to Class 5, providing them with a foundation in basic education.
The school primarily uses Telugu as the medium of instruction, ensuring that students are comfortable learning in their native language. With a single male teacher, the school prioritizes individual attention and personalized learning. The school operates under the management of the local body, highlighting its commitment to serving the community.
While MPPS NANDIGANIPALLI does not have a pre-primary section, it is a primary school only, offering education for students between the ages of 6 and 11. As a rural school, it emphasizes providing basic education to children in the surrounding areas, ensuring access to learning opportunities for all.
The school operates under a "Others" board for both Class 10th and Class 10+2, indicating its flexibility in aligning with local educational requirements. It's important to note that the school lacks access to basic amenities like computers, electricity, and reliable drinking water.
